Event Text
CONTROL ROOM EMERGENCY VENTILATION (CREV) SYSTEM INOPERABLE
"On September 04, 2014, at 1905 hours [CDT], the Control Room Emergency Ventilation (CREV) system was declared inoperable due to the Air Handling Unit (AHU) tripping upon restoration of Control Room Ventilation following testing of Reactor Building Ventilation instrumentation. Troubleshooting is in progress at this time.
"Technical Specification 3.7.4, Condition A, was entered which requires the CREV system to be restored to an operable status in seven (7) days. Additionally, Technical Specification 3.7.5, Condition A, was entered which requires CREV AC to be restored to an operable status in 30 days.
"This notification is being made in accordance with 10CFR50.72(b)(3)(v)(D), ’[any] event or condition that could have prevented fulfillment of a safety function,’ because the CREV system is a single train system required to mitigate the consequences of an accident."
The licensee has notified the NRC Resident Inspector.
